About Diamond Vogel Lemon Bubble
Lemon Bubble is very light — LRV 84, close to white. It opens up small or dim rooms and keeps walls feeling airy. Its orange und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. In north light it can read slightly cooler; a warm white trim alongside keeps it from going clinical.
Lemon Bubble shines on ceilings, trim and in small or low-light rooms where you need to stretch the light — and as a calm whole-home backdrop. Yellows lift kitchens, hallways and kids' rooms with warmth.

Diamond Vogel Lemon Bubble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Lemon Bubble from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Diamond Vogel 0931 direct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Sherwin-Williams Equivalent of Lemon Bubble
At Sherwin-Williams, the closest color to Lemon Bubble is Glittery Yellow (SW 7125) — very close at ΔE 2.65,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 85 vs 84) and carries a warm yellow und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Glittery Yellow swatch →
Behr Equivalent of Lemon Bubble
Behr's nearest match is Papaya Sorbet (P250-1),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.64).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 85 vs 84) and carries a warm red-orange undertone, so it substitutes for Lemon Bubble without repainting risk. See the full Papaya Sorbet swatch →
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Lemon Bubble
The closest Benjamin Moore equivalent of Lemon Bubble is Old World Romance (303). At ΔE 0.41 the two are indistinguishable on a wall — it carries the same warm red-orange undertone and runs slightly darker (LRV 80 vs 84). If Benjamin Moore is your counter, order Old World Romance and you'll get the same color. See the full Old World Romance swatch →
